Job Title:Â Principal Designer, Apparel - HOKA Innovation
Reports to:Â Sr Director, Design - HOKA Innovation
Location: Portland, OR (Hybrid)
Typically 3 times per week in office, Tuesday – Thursday
The Role
As Principal Designer, Apparel – HOKA Innovation, you’ll drive the creative exploration of what’s next in performance apparel. You’ll collaborate with elite athletes, engineers, sports scientists, and developers to translate insights into innovative concepts and technologies. Your energy, passion, and expertise will help shape breakthrough solutions that transform athlete experiences and push the boundaries of what’s possible.

Your Impact
- Design and engineer future performance apparel that blends innovation, athlete needs, and HOKA’s design DNA
- Manage and drive innovation projects aligned to the HOKA innovation strategy, roadmap, and calendar
- Develop and refine accurate 2D and 3D design techpacks, renderings, and compelling product storytelling
- Collaborate with elite athletes and the HOKA sports science and testing team to test, iterate, and refine products
- Translate athlete and consumer insights into advanced concepts and radical product solutions
- Explore new materials, constructions, and aesthetics that bring meaningful newness to performance product
- Travel with the team for design, development, and inspiration trips to factories, tradeshows, and athlete events
- Contribute to HOKA global design strategy and seasonal direction, shaping progressive performance narratives
Who You Are
- Bachelor’s degree in apparel, footwear, industrial, transportation design, or equivalent combination of education and experience
- 8-10+ years of related performance apparel design experience
- 1-3+ years of people management experience preferred
- Lead by example, set a high creative standard, and inspire teammates through collaboration and constructive feedback
- Confident working fast, generating provocative ideas, and visualizing radical new concepts
- Balance creativity and high design with technical manufacturing possibilities and constraints
- Strong written and verbal communication, collaboration, ideation, and brainstorming skills
- Mastery of advanced digital AI co-creation design tools (Adobe Illustrator, Photoshop, Figma, Rhino, Grasshopper, Blender, Clo, Keyshot, Gravity Sketch, Vizcom, Midjourney, Claude) and proficiency in Microsoft applications
- Ability to self-start, tinker, build, and prototype early concepts into tangible mockups and samples
- Advanced design thinking, creativity, and strategic approach, translating ambiguity into clear design direction
- Expertise in technical performance apparel, including materials, construction, fit, sustainability, and advanced manufacturing
- Deep care and understanding of sustainability and circularity concepts and practices
- Manage complex projects, meetings, timelines, and competing priorities with organization and attention to detail
- Build and maintain a strong creative vision across projects and industry landscape
- Partner effectively with internal and external teams, including consumer insights, athlete science, design, testing, development, engineering, and agency partners
- Create compelling narratives, presentations, and design stories for senior leadership and cross-functional partners
- Obsess athletes, consumers, markets, and trends, translating insights into relevant, progressive performance product
- Highly motivated team player and self-starter with a curious, growth mindset and focus on continuous learning
